🔢 Gouldian Finch Hatch Date Calculator (16-Day Incubation)

Instant results. No downloads.

Enter your egg set date and immediately see the expected hatch date based on the standard 16-day Gouldian incubation period. This tool helps you:

  • Anticipate hatch windows

  • Prepare soft food and supplements on time

  • Plan lockdown and observation days

  • Reduce missed or rushed hatches
